Hello,

please describe the simulation you are planning (airfoil, Reynolds number, Tu...) and your setup problems.

In general, it's a good idea to use a working case which uses a similar turbulence model as a starting point and make adjustments rather than creating a new setup from scratch. You could use a steady state (simpleFoam) case which uses e.g. kOmegaSST if you have one and you should look at the tutorials maybe there's a case using the model you want to use.

To get an idea about calculating the model specific initial values (specific 0 folder content for gammaInt and ReThetat) read the academic papers describing the model:

Langtry, R. B., & Menter, F. R. (2009).
Correlation-based transition modeling for unstructured parallelized
computational fluid dynamics codes.
AIAA journal, 47(12), 2894-2906.

Menter, F. R., Langtry, R., & Volker, S. (2006).
Transition modelling for general purpose CFD codes.
Flow, turbulence and combustion, 77(1-4), 277-303.

Langtry, R. B. (2006).
A correlation-based transition model using local variables for
unstructured parallelized CFD codes.
Phd. Thesis, Universität Stuttgart.
